Construction of a motorcycle mower

Although gasoline trimmers may differ in small details, they still have a similar overall design. Under the plastic housing is the heart of the trimmer — the engine (1). On the left side, the device is equipped with a fuel tank (2) of a certain volume, into which a mixture of oil and gasoline is poured, in the proportions specified by the manufacturer (for two-stroke engines). Almost all models have a rubber or foam hip protection (3) located on a rod in the immediate vicinity of the engine, which reduces vibration transmitted to the operator's hip. Below there are rubberized handles, on one of which there is a control system (4) in the form of a throttle valve and a start lock button.

An aluminium or steel rod (5) is connected to a gearbox (7), which is responsible for rotating the nozzle (8). To protect the operator from grass flying in all directions, the trimmer design provides plastic or metal protection (6).

Features that you should pay attention to when choosing

Before buying, pay attention to the following indicators:

  • Power. The power of the mower largely affects its performance. For regular mowing (maintenance) of the lawn, models from 800 to 1500 watts are quite suitable. For mowing high and dense grass, it is worth looking at models from 1500 to 2500 watts. And if it is necessary to mow the "virgin land" or trim the sprouts of trees, then it is worth buying an aggregate with a power of over 2500 watts. Professional models with a capacity of 3000 – 4000 watts will be of interest to utilities and private companies engaged in cleaning the city from overgrowth.
  • Engine type. Most of the moccasins are equipped with two-stroke engines, the power of which is enough for almost all tasks. However, their disadvantage is a rather high noise, so it is extremely necessary to use headphones when working to avoid hearing damage. Also, two-stroke engines are fueled with a mixture of oil and gasoline, mixing up the proportions of which can harm the device. Some models, such as the Makita EBH 341U, have a four-stroke engine, which is less noisy compared to a two-stroke and consumes less fuel. Also, the filling of oil and gasoline is carried out in different tanks, so it will not work to "overdo it" with the dosage. However, units equipped with four-stroke engines are heavier than two-stroke analogues, and they are more expensive.
  • The design of the rod. The most common are straight barbells. Inside the aluminium or steel rod there is a metal shaft that transmits rotational impulses to the gearbox, and that in turn turns the nozzle. Thanks to this design feature, it is the models with straight rods that are the most powerful. For most tasks, such gasoline pumps are quite enough. The only downside is slightly more weight than models with other types of barbells. In models with curved rods, instead of a shaft, there is a steel cable that rotates the nozzle. Unfortunately, it cannot transmit the same torque as the shaft, so motorcycle mowers with curved rods are equipped with small engines in the range from 0.8 to 1.1 hp. But curved ones are easier to process flowerbeds, trim the "curly" lawn and cut grass under benches. Trimmers with a curved rod are suitable for those who plan to trim low thin grass, as well as for regular lawn treatment. Also, their advantage is a relatively small weight of up to 5 kg. There are also models of collapsible type, both with straight and curved rods. Their advantage is compactness in disassembled condition, which is very important during transportation (can be transported in the boot) and storage in the garage.

  • The width of the mowing. This indicator determines the distance that the cutting nozzle of the trimmer captures. There is a relationship between the power of the device and the width of the grass: the more powerful the device, the easier it will be for him to cut a wider area. The optimal mowing width for gasoline trimmers is forty centimeters — suitable for medium and large areas.
  • Working nozzle. As standard, each mower is equipped with a spool with a fishing line wound on it. This nozzle is convenient for mowing soft grass and mowing the lawn. In principle, it can mow thick grass, but then it will quickly wear off. For most models it is better to take a fishing line from 2 to 2.8 mm thick (if the diameter of the hole in the spool allows). Note that the material of the fishing line must withstand the high temperature that arises from friction, so as not to melt and stick to the spool. Therefore, when choosing components, check with the seller whether the fishing line can withstand 200 degrees. If you have to prune thickets and thick grass, it is better to use a blade knife or a disk. The second mowing width is usually smaller, but it is able to cut small trees well.

  • Belt. Considering that most models weigh more than 5 kg, it is worth buying with a two-shoulder strap, especially if you plan to mow the grass for several hours. Some manufacturers, such as STIHL, produce comfortable straps over two shoulders with plastic hip protection from vibrations. Please note that most mowers provide the possibility of attaching a belt from a third-party manufacturer, so a suitable option can always be purchased separately.

  • Protective cover. It is extremely dangerous to work without this part, so it should always be in good condition on the spit. The casings are plastic and metal. If you have to mow on a site where there are a lot of stones and other hard objects that can fly away from a metal disk, then the plastic protection can simply break — a metal casing is needed here. It is not always included, but it can be purchased at any time. When buying, pay attention to the size of the disks that will "become" under one or another casing.

  • The shape of the handle. Trimmers with a looped handle are usually relatively light devices up to 5.5 kg (heavy models are less common). This form of handle has only one advantage over the bicycle — portability, thanks to which the device is easier to transport. Otherwise, the bicycle mowing is superior to the arc-shaped one in terms of convenience: it is easier for her to drive a scythe on the grass and her hands get tired less.

  • Weight. If long-term frequent mowing of grass is planned, it is best to take models with a weight of 3 to 6 kg. The purchase of heavy powerful units weighing up to 12 kg is due only to the need for constant mowing of thick sprouts of trees, therefore it will be of interest to utility companies.

Important: if almost any engine oil is suitable for the gearbox of the mower (in the "purpose" section, select "gasoline tool"), then for the engine it is worth taking only the oil specified by the manufacturer, which is mixed in a certain proportion with gasoline (for 2-stroke engines). If you add more oil, then the engine will smoke, and if less, then rapid wear of friction units will occur — regularly monitor the strict observance of proportions.

Conclusions

To maintain the lawn in proper condition, as well as for mowing low thin grass, it is worth taking light motorcycle mowers with a curved rod with a power of up to 1000 watts. If you have to mow "virgin land" with high dense grass, it is better to look at the models 1500 – 2500 watts, and purchase an additional blade knife or disc for pruning the growth. The purchase of professional powerful units is justified only for utility companies or specialized private companies.
